AKC Classification
Compare AKC groups for Scottish Deerhound, Border Collie, and Cairn Terrier. How are they classified?
Recognized by the American Kennel Club in 1886 as a Hound breed. Recognized by the American Kennel Club in 1995 as a Herding breed. Recognized by the American Kennel Club in 1913 as a Terrier breed.
FCI Classification
Compare FCI groups for Scottish Deerhound, Border Collie, and Cairn Terrier. How are they classified internationally?
Recognized by FCI in the Sighthounds group, in the Rough-haired Sighthounds section. Recognized by FCI in the Sheepdogs and Cattledogs (except Swiss Cattledogs) group, in the Sheepdogs section. Recognized by FCI in the Terriers group, in the Small sized Terriers section.
